Vanilla Doom ran only in a tweaked VGA "Mode 13h" 320x200 video mode. On properly configured CRT monitors, which were the only widely available and inexpensive consumer display device for computers at the time, this video mode took up the entire screen, which had a 4:3 physical aspect ratio. This meant that the 320x200 display, with a 16:10 logical ratio, was stretched vertically - each pixel was 20% taller than it was wide.

have you ever ttied that cheats in heretic?

Also made by ID Soft but the cheats had a negative effect. Idkfa the all items cheats would strip you of all your weapons and the game would actually call you a cheater. Iddqd the god mode cheat would kill you instantly.
